37. Salt Lake Tribune reported it...
http://www.sltrib.com/search/ci_3211051

They didn't report the profanity angle, but there is not much detail.

"A South Jordan man who died Friday night when he jumped from a moving vehicle was identified as Tyler Paulson, 21. Police said Paulson was a passenger in the rear seat of a Dodge 4-door pickup. He opened the door and jumped from the truck near 10800 S. 1300 West about 6:15 p.m., said Deputy Chief Chris Evans. The truck was going about 35 mph. Paulson suffered severe head injuries. He was pronounced dead at Jordan Valley Hospital."
